MTx stands for any type of MTC, MTA, MTK

MFx stands for any type of MFC, MFA, MFK

Features

  • Isolated mounting base 3000V~
  • Pressure contact technology with
  • Increased power cycling capability
  • Space and weight saving

Typical Applications

  • AC/DC Motor drives
  • Various rectifiers
  • DC supply for PWM inverte
